MacBook Air Core Shutdown Video
Jason Snell over at Macworld.com has posted a video covering the issues surrounding the MacBook Air core shutdown problem I detailed a few months ago.
Like me, Jason has seen a marked improvement following the installation of Coolbook‘.
Since my original post I am happy to report that I have seen no real side effects to the underclocking; certainly no kernel panics or OS instability. Battery life was waned a little and ranges anywhere between 3.5hrs to 4hrs. This maybe because my MBA battery has now been cycled 251 times and is no longer keeping an optimal charge.
But after 4 months use I can say with certainty that it’s one of the best $10 I have ever spent. If I hadn’t discovered Coolbook I would have had no choice but to return my MacBook Air to the Apple Store for a refund.
